House raising services involve elevating a home to address issues related to flooding, moisture intrusion, or structural concerns. The process typically includes lifting the entire structure off its foundation, often using hydraulic jacks or other specialized equipment, to create a new, higher foundation or to repair existing foundational elements. Once the house is raised, contractors may reinforce or replace the foundation and ensure the home’s stability before lowering it back onto the new support. This service is often employed as part of a comprehensive flood mitigation strategy or to prepare a property for future construction or renovations.
The primary problems that house raising services help solve include flood risk reduction, foundation deterioration, and water damage. Homes situated in flood-prone areas or those experiencing recurring water intrusion benefit from elevation to minimize potential damage during heavy rains or rising waters. Additionally, older homes with compromised or settling foundations may require lifting to restore structural integrity or to prevent further deterioration. By elevating a property, homeowners can also meet local building codes that mandate higher foundation levels in flood zones, helping to protect their investment and improve safety.

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$30,000 and $100,000, depending on the home's size and foundation type. For example, raising a small single-family home might be closer to $30,000, while larger or more complex projects can exceed $80,000.
Factors Affecting Cost - The overall expense varies based on foundation type, home size, and the extent of structural modifications needed. Additional costs may include permits, utilities disconnection, and debris removal, which can add several thousand dollars.
Average Price Breakdown - On average, house raising costs around $50,000 to $75,000 in Maryland Heights, MO, with some projects reaching over $100,000 for extensive work. Smaller or less complex homes tend to be at the lower end of this range.
